Bitcoin (BTC) marks 13 years when its market cap was just over 570 pizzas

May 22 is a significant milestone in the history of Bitcoin (BTC) and the burgeoning crypto landscape at large. On May 22nd, 2013, 13 years ago today, Laslo Hanyecz, one of the earliest Bitcoin (BTC) investors and adopters, infamously paid 10,000 Bitcoin (BTC) in exchange for two pizzas. At that time, it was a great deal, as a Bitcoin (BTC) was worth just 0.44 cents and the transaction totaled $41. But today, the reverse is the case. In retrospect, Laslo would have wished he didn’t spend so much on pizza, which is worth over $270 million based on Bitcoin’s (BTC) current valuation—making it the world’s most expensive snack. This memorable event, which has now become a legend, serves as a reminder of how far Bitcoin (BTC) has come in terms of growth and adoption.
